实现博客的增删改
# 13.5 实现博客的增删改
前面介绍了beego框架实现的整体构思以及部分实现的伪代码,这小节介绍通过beego建立一个博客系统,包括博客浏览、添加、修改、删除等操作。
## 博客目录
博客目录如下所示:
.
├── controllers
│ ├── delete.go
│ ├── edit.go
│ ├── index.go
│ ├── new.go
│ └── view.go
├── main.go
├── models
│ └── model.go
└── views
├── edit.tpl
├── index.tpl
├── layout.tpl
├── new.tpl
└── view.tpl
## 博客路由
博客主要的路由规则如下所示:
undefined
## 数据库结构
数据库设计最简单的博客信息
undefined
## 控制器
IndexController:
undefined
ViewController:
undefined
NewController
undefined
EditController
undefined
DeleteController
undefined
## model层
undefined
## view层
layout.tpl
undefined
index.tpl
undefined
view.tpl
undefined
new.tpl
undefined
edit.tpl
undefined
## links
* {% post_link preface 目录 %}
* 上一章: {% post_link 13.4 日志和配置设计 %}
* 下一节: {% post_link 13.6 小结 %}